Skip to main content

NVIDIA cuQuantum SDK

Project description

NVIDIA cuQuantum SDK is a set of high-performance libraries and tools for accelerating quantum computing simulations at both the circuit and device level by orders of magnitude. It consists of three major components:

  • cuDensityMat: a high-performance library for quantum dynamics equation solvers

  • cuStateVec: a high-performance library for state vector quantum simulators

  • cuTensorNet: a high-performance library for tensor network computations

In addition to C APIs, cuQuantum also provides Python APIs via cuQuantum Python.

Documentation

Please refer to https://docs.nvidia.com/cuda/cuquantum/index.html for the cuQuantum documentation.

Installation

The cuQuantum wheel can be installed as follows:

pip install cuquantum-cuXX

where XX is the CUDA major version (currently CUDA 12 and 13 are supported). We encourage users to install package with the -cuXX suffix;

Citing cuQuantum

H. Bayraktar et al., “cuQuantum SDK: A High-Performance Library for Accelerating Quantum Science,” 2023 IEEE International Conference on Quantum Computing and Engineering (QCE), Bellevue, WA, USA, 2023, pp. 1050-1061, doi: 10.1109/QCE57702.2023.00119

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distributions

No source distribution files available for this release.See tutorial on generating distribution archives.

Built Distributions

File details

Details for the file cuquantum_cu12-25.9.0-py3-none-man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for cuquantum_cu12-25.9.0-py3-none-man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 800094fd256c28a1c1a5ff5293be2d2a53ae34725bacbe378684d15b17ada3b4
MD5 a28f73b9a633c69d4bc3f91ab2aacc14
BLAKE2b-256 e6dcbb77d68b8a9bb855b867dff389dc2f40f2b3fa24377fa49c71438efa82af

See more details on using hashes here.

File details

Details for the file cuquantum_cu12-25.9.0-py3-none-manylinux2014_aarch64.whl.

File metadata

File hashes

Hashes for cuquantum_cu12-25.9.0-py3-none-manylinux2014_aarch64.whl
Algorithm Hash digest
SHA256 7682090d30371604a5d615bc069a2197837e84f49f8a5d90a80e5aa3c1925c3f
MD5 0b503dbc9caa81fef317aa643b7863d9
BLAKE2b-256 1524adaa329e529cf74c89dd78250613192e859a0f9e45dd0eac966ca9e50d36

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page